Transaction 6f8c86ab85e7c325d2913a2a75ce43668a18d8a70d1e7cc4709dc53616a43c5d
1 Input
1 Output
-
6f8c86ab85e7c325d2913a2a75ce43668a18d8a70d1e7cc4709dc53616a43c5d:0
- value
- 150214600
- script pubkey
- OP_0 OP_PUSHBYTES_20 03765ded72b9b55f38ea1678ddec193f1078a064
- address
- bc1qqdm9mmtjhx647w82zeudmmqe8ug83grypg35qj